Skateboard Essentials: Decks, Trucks, and Wheels
At the heart of skateboarding lies the gear, and the Vans outlet provides a thorough lineup. First and foremost, the selection of skateboard decks is expansive, catering to varying styles from the street slayers to ramp rovers. Brands like Santa Cruz and Blind stand shoulder to shoulder with Vans’ own offerings, providing everything from classic popsicle shapes to wider boards suited for cruising.
When it comes to trucks, the option for both lightweight and sturdy options is available. Independent and Thunder trucks present choices for those looking to achieve the optimal balance of durability and maneuverability. And of course, we can’t forget about wheels. The right wheels can make all the difference; softer durometers for street skating allow for extra grip, whereas harder wheels might serve well for smooth, slick surfaces at skate parks.

Origins of Vans Footwear
Founded in 1966 by brothers Paul and Jim Van Doren alongside partners Gordon Lee and Serge D’Elia in Anaheim, California, Vans initially started as a small custom sneaker shop. It was a place where customers could walk in, choose styles and colors, and leave with a personalized pair of shoes. This grassroots approach to footwear laid the foundation for a culture built on independence and creativity. The true peak of the brand's innovation came with the launch of the NOW iconic Slip-On in the early 1970s. This shoe quickly became a hit, particularly in the skateboarding community, known for its simplicity and ease of use, making it the perfect choice for skaters.
Key Milestones in Vans History:
- First shoe factory opened in California, 1966.
- Introduction of the Vans #44 Deck Shoe, 1977.
- The Slip-On becomes a style icon, 1978.
- Vans sponsors its first amateur skateboard team, 1982.
These milestones show how a humble business transformed into a global player in both fashion and sport. As the brand grew, so too did its connection with the growing skate culture of the 1980s. Vans had become a staple in skate parks and on the streets, where style met functionality, and the shoes’ durability was perfect for the wear and tear of tricks and stunts.

Innovative Designs Over the Years
From its inception, Vans has always been about standing apart from the crowd. The brand caught the eye of skateboarders with its Off the Wall slogan, emphasizing not just a product, but the identity of a daring lifestyle. The introduction of the iconic Vans Old Skool in 1977 marked a turning point; the classic side stripe added a distinctive flair that would eventually become synonymous with skate culture. Over the decades, Vans has successfully experimented with various materials, colors, and patterns, making each new season an exciting opportunity for self-expression.
- Collaborations with Artists: Vans has engaged in partnerships with artists and designers like Takashi Murakami and Kim Jones, resulting in limited edition collections that appeal to both skaters and collectors alike. These collaborations have pushed the boundaries of design, integrating art into streetwear.
- Performance-Driven Features: Van's commitment to functionality is evident in their innovative features. For instance, the introduction of Pro Skate footwear that includes enhanced cushioning, stronger materials, and precise grip showcases how Vans doesn't compromise on performance while keeping style at the forefront.
- Sustainable Practices: As the world shifts towards eco-consciousness, Vans responded by launching eco-friendly collections that use recycled materials. This not only sways environmentally-aware consumers but also demonstrates that good design can be responsible.


Through all these innovations, it’s clear that Vans remains adaptable, balancing tradition and contemporary sensibilities.
